For those of you having trouble with the vines here is how I did it. I had a LOT of trouble with it too, and this is a fairly easy way to do it.
1. First lay your vines out in five piles of the different types.
2. Pick up all six of the first type and click the clearing. If it shows the rope being lowered keep those ones. If it doesn't put all those ones down and try the next set of six until you find the six that does give you the lowering screen.
3. Next pick up ONE of the other vines. Click the clearing and if it gives the lowering screen, keep that vine. If it doesn't put that vine down again, and try another type of vine til you pick up one that gives you the screen.
4. Now pick up another ONE of the vines that gave the lowering screen. Does the lowering screen appear again? Yes? Keep that vine, and try another one of that type til you don't get that screen. Put down the last one that you picked up.
5. Move on til you find another vine-type that gives you the lowering screen, and do as in 4. until the screen stops coming.
6. Keep going with steps 3 - 5 until you've finished. As long as you add only one at a time after the initial six the monster shouldn't take your rope either so you won't have to find all the vines again.
You should have done the vines bit now! :yes: Congrats! Any problems just ask, I'll see what advice I can give.
